Course Introduction

Construction and demolition activities generate some of the largest waste streams globally, including concrete, bricks, timber, metals, asphalt, glass, plastics, gypsum, and excavated materials. Without effective recycling and recovery systems, these materials place enormous pressure on landfills, increase environmental pollution, and waste valuable natural resources. This course provides participants with comprehensive knowledge and practical skills to establish efficient construction and demolition (C&D) waste recycling systems that improve sustainability, reduce disposal costs, and promote circular economy practices throughout the construction sector.

Governments, municipalities, and construction industries are increasingly implementing stricter environmental regulations, green building standards, and waste diversion targets to reduce construction-related environmental impacts. Organizations must adopt integrated waste management strategies that prioritize waste prevention, segregation, material recovery, recycling, and resource efficiency while ensuring compliance with environmental legislation. Participants will gain practical understanding of regulatory frameworks, policy implementation, and sustainable waste governance within construction and infrastructure development projects.

Modern construction waste management emphasizes recovering valuable materials for reuse in new projects, reducing dependence on virgin resources, lowering greenhouse gas emissions, and improving project profitability. Participants will examine recycling technologies, material recovery facilities, quality assurance procedures, and sustainable procurement practices that maximize resource recovery while supporting environmentally responsible construction practices across both public and private sector developments.

Digital transformation is reshaping construction waste management through Building Information Modeling (BIM), Geographic Information Systems (GIS), Internet of Things sensors, waste tracking applications, environmental monitoring platforms, and data-driven reporting systems. Participants will explore how digital technologies improve waste forecasting, recycling performance, compliance monitoring, logistics optimization, and evidence-based decision-making throughout construction project lifecycles.

Successful construction waste recycling requires strong collaboration among project owners, contractors, consultants, regulators, waste service providers, recycling companies, engineers, architects, and local communities. Participants will learn stakeholder engagement approaches, environmental communication strategies, contractual responsibilities, procurement considerations, and partnership models that strengthen integrated waste management while supporting sustainable infrastructure development.

Upon successful completion of this course, participants will possess practical competencies to design, implement, monitor, and continuously improve construction and demolition waste recycling systems. They will be equipped to strengthen environmental compliance, increase recycling rates, reduce project costs, improve operational efficiency, support circular economy initiatives, and contribute to sustainable construction and infrastructure development through responsible waste management practices.
